Sonnet: On H I V



In sexual orgies, when immersed you had,
In Adultery, a life you loved to spend,
Much more than wine, women seduced you lad,
Alas! Succumbed to retroviral end!

Was oro-anal sex practiced quite safe?
Was blood transfused, free off the virus load?
Was love you made, worth it in every café?
How long did you walk down the red-lit road?

O sad victim of the AIDS pandemic!
Your days are numbered in weeks, not in years!
Alas! Of mind and body, thou art sick;
Thy self-dug grave, thy melting frame well nears!

Beware Mankind; the scourge could wipe thy race,
If Thou canst wear a renewed moral face!
